Clowns Without Borders South Africa (www.cwbsa.org) is an artist led humanitarian organisation dedicated to using arts interventions to provide psychosocial support to children and guardians affected by crisis around the world. Since 2004, we have worked with over 270,000 children and guardians bringing laughter and humour to where it is needed most.
